**jatoolsPrinter 使用手册** **简介** jatoolsPrinter 是一款专为满足网页套打需求而设计的打印控件,它弥补了浏览器原生打印功能在精确分页、套打等高级功能上的不足。作为 web 应用开发者的重要辅助工具,它提供了一种精细化的打印控制,允许用户控制打印目标打印机、纸张类型、页眉页脚、分页方式以及附件处理等,极大地提升了web报表和票据的打印体验。 **安装指南** 服务端安装非常灵活,支持各种操作系统(如Windows,包括Windows 7+)和常见的web服务器环境,例如IIS、Tomcat、WebLogic、Websphere等。这意味着它能够无缝集成到不同的开发平台和服务器架构中。 **快速入门** - 安装完成后,只需将jatoolsPrinter 控件文件放置在web服务器的特定目录即可视为配置完成。这简化了部署过程,与传统的报表工具相比,无需额外配置复杂的报表服务引擎。 **基本操作** 1. **打印预览**:通过jatoolsPrinter,开发者可以轻松预览打印效果,确保文档在实际打印时符合预期。 2. **打印参数设置**: - **首次打印**:使用当前配置;后续打印则会采用最后一次的打印配置,方便连续打印。 - **批量打印**:支持多个文档在同一web页面中进行区分打印,提高效率。 3. **隐藏对象打印**:有些元素可能在预览时可见但不会实际输出,这有助于保护敏感信息或在预览阶段展示非最终版内容。 4. **回调方法**:jatoolsPrinter 提供回调机制,便于在打印过程中的数据提交和处理,确保流程的顺畅。 5. **打印后管理**:打印结束后,可以根据需求提交数据,同时提供打印窗口关闭功能,便于用户体验。 **高级功能** - **自动分页**:表格可以自动分页,确保表头在每一页都可见,提升打印质量。 - **双面打印**:支持用户选择双面打印模式,节省纸张资源。 - **页面设置**:允许用户在打印前显示页面设置对话框,自定义打印选项。 **API参考** 作为一款基于底层HTML的打印工具,jatoolsPrinter 不包含可视化的报表设计工具,这意味着前端开发者可以根据后端生成的HTML结构灵活定制打印样式。开发者可以利用API来定制自己的打印界面,以适应项目的具体需求。 **对比报表工具** 相比于其他功能更为全面的报表工具,如杰表.2008,jatoolsPrinter 更专注于web客户端的打印,对于数据处理和格式化方面,用户需要自行在服务器端进行开发。如果你需要更多功能,如可视化设计、多种导出格式以及更复杂的数据处理,建议考虑使用杰表.2008作为整体解决方案。 jatoolsPrinter 是一个实用且灵活的打印控件,特别适合web开发者在处理套打和定制打印需求时使用,但需要结合后端开发工作来生成和格式化页面内容。
剩余26页未读,继续阅读
- 粉丝: 1
- 资源: 7
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- AirKiss技术详解:无线传递信息与智能家居连接
- Hibernate主键生成策略详解
- 操作系统实验:位示图法管理磁盘空闲空间
- JSON详解:数据交换的主流格式
- Win7安装Ubuntu双系统详细指南
- FPGA内部结构与工作原理探索
- 信用评分模型解析:WOE、IV与ROC
- 使用LVS+Keepalived构建高可用负载均衡集群
- 微信小程序驱动餐饮与服装业创新转型:便捷管理与低成本优势
- 机器学习入门指南:从基础到进阶
- 解决Win7 IIS配置错误500.22与0x80070032
- SQL-DFS:优化HDFS小文件存储的解决方案
- Hadoop、Hbase、Spark环境部署与主机配置详解
- Kisso:加密会话Cookie实现的单点登录SSO
- OpenCV读取与拼接多幅图像教程
- QT实战:轻松生成与解析JSON数据